According to the Dietary Guidelines for Americas, 2010, nearly 24 million people—almost 11 percent of the U.S. population—ages 20 years and older have diabetes. The vast majority of cases are type 2 diabetes, which is heavily influenced by diet and physical activity. About 78 million Americans—35 percent of the U.S. adult population ages 20 years or older—have pre-diabetes. Reducing our sugar intake is just one of the many ways to help prevent diabetes, as well as several other problems.
